Step 1

Indicate what could be wrong with Jabu's ankle joint.

96%

114 rated

Answer

Jabu's ankle joint could be suffering from various conditions, such as:

  • Tendinitis: Inflammation of the tendons due to overuse.
  • Sprains: Stretching or tearing of ligaments surrounding the joint.
  • Fracture: A break in the bone that may result from trauma.

Step 2

Describe THREE possible causes of Jabu's injury.

99%

104 rated

Answer

  1. Incorrect Technique: Poor execution of dance moves can place undue stress on the ankle, leading to injuries.

  2. Overuse: Repeatedly performing intense dance routines without adequate rest can cause strain and fatigue in the ankle.

  3. Environmental Factors: Dancing on uneven or slippery surfaces increases the risk of ankle injuries.

Step 3

Explain FOUR possible treatments for Jabu's ankle joint injury.

96%

101 rated

Answer

  1. Rest: Cease all activities that put pressure on the ankle to allow for healing.

  2. Compression: Use of bandages to minimize swelling and support the joint.

  3. Elevation: Keeping the injured ankle elevated to reduce swelling.

  4. Physiotherapy: Engaging in physical therapy for guided exercises that help in recovery.

Step 4

Describe THREE exercises that Jabu could do to maintain his overall fitness while his injury is healing.

98%

120 rated

Answer

  1. Upper Body Workouts: Engage in exercises focusing on the upper body to maintain strength without stressing the ankle.

  2. Core Exercises: Incorporate core-strengthening routines, such as planks, to keep overall fitness levels up.

  3. Gentle Range of Motion Exercises: If advised by a physiotherapist, gentle movements of the ankle may help maintain mobility without adding strain.

Step 5

Discuss FOUR challenges that Jabu could face when he returns to the dance class once the injury has healed.

97%

117 rated

Answer

  1. Decreased Fitness: A drop in cardiovascular fitness can affect stamina during dance routines.

  2. Loss of Muscle Strength: Weakness in the ankle may make it difficult to perform moves that require power and precision.

  3. Joint Stability Issues: The ankle may not feel as stable during high-impact movements, increasing the risk of re-injury.

  4. Mental Barriers: Fear of injury may hinder Jabu's confidence and performance levels upon returning to dance.
